Create Signed SOAP XML for DIAN Colombia WCF Service

Demonstrates how to create a signed SOAP XML document for DIAN Colombia.Chilkat Delphi ActiveX Downloads
uses
Winapi.Windows, Winapi.Messages, System.SysUtils, System.Variants, System.Classes, Vcl.Graphics,
Vcl.Controls, Vcl.Forms, Vcl.Dialogs, Vcl.StdCtrls, Chilkat_TLB;
...
procedure TForm1.Button1Click(Sender: TObject);
var
success: Integer;
xmlToSign: TChilkatXml;
gen: TChilkatXmlDSigGen;
cert: TChilkatCert;
xmlCustomKeyInfo: TChilkatXml;
sbXml: TChilkatStringBuilder;
bdCert: TChilkatBinData;
nReplaced: Integer;
verifier: TChilkatXmlDSig;
numSigs: Integer;
verifyIdx: Integer;
verified: Integer;
begin
success := 0;
// This example requires the Chilkat API to have been previously unlocked.
// See Global Unlock Sample for sample code.
// This example will produce a signed SOAP XML message that looks like this:
// <?xml version="1.0" encoding="utf-8"?>
// <soap:Envelope xmlns:soap="http://www.w3.org/2003/05/soap-envelope" xmlns:wcf="http://wcf.dian.colombia">
// <soap:Header xmlns:wsa="http://www.w3.org/2005/08/addressing">
// <wsse:Security xmlns:wsse="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-wssecurity-secext-1.0.xsd" xmlns:wsu="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-wssecurity-utility-1.0.xsd">
// <wsu:Timestamp wsu:Id="TS-F25839120CBA3ECDAD68754D0443A667636FDA68">
// <wsu:Created>2019-08-23T23:03:01Z</wsu:Created>
// <wsu:Expires>2019-08-24T15:43:01Z</wsu:Expires>
// </wsu:Timestamp>
// <wsse:BinarySecurityToken EncodingType="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-soap-message-security-1.0#Base64Binary"
// ValueType="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-x509-token-profile-1.0#X509v3"
// wsu:Id="ABCXYZ-9F0F7E15A59816E680B4735080A789DC1EED6C9C">MIIG8jCCBd ... zLjGQUB6lcz</wsse:BinarySecurityToken>
// <ds:Signature Id="SIG-F25839120CBA3ECDAD68754D0443A667636FDA68" xmlns:ds="http://www.w3.org/2000/09/xmldsig#">
// <ds:SignedInfo>
// <ds:CanonicalizationMethod Algorithm="http://www.w3.org/2001/10/xml-exc-c14n#">
// <ec:InclusiveNamespaces PrefixList="wsa soap wcf" xmlns:ec="http://www.w3.org/2001/10/xml-exc-c14n#"/>
// </ds:CanonicalizationMethod>
// <ds:SignatureMethod Algorithm="http://www.w3.org/2001/04/xmldsig-more#rsa-sha256"/>
// <ds:Reference URI="#ID-F25839120CBA3ECDAD68754D0443A667636FDA68">
// <ds:Transforms>
// <ds:Transform Algorithm="http://www.w3.org/2001/10/xml-exc-c14n#">
// <ec:InclusiveNamespaces PrefixList="soap wcf" xmlns:ec="http://www.w3.org/2001/10/xml-exc-c14n#"/>
// </ds:Transform>
// </ds:Transforms>
// <ds:DigestMethod Algorithm="http://www.w3.org/2001/04/xmlenc#sha256"/>
// <ds:DigestValue>gSIKtjS/BKA2bgecXkM8lYVBDqlXcU3juNYT9a+bSnM=</ds:DigestValue>
// </ds:Reference>
// </ds:SignedInfo>
// <ds:SignatureValue>sL7rOdyfkEnKgJja0eWrv ... YqG0T0pflBsGW9zXkjQ9NvAw==</ds:SignatureValue>
// <ds:KeyInfo Id="KI-F25839120CBA3ECDAD68754D0443A667636FDA68">
// <wsse:SecurityTokenReference wsu:Id="STR-F25839120CBA3ECDAD68754D0443A667636FDA68">
// <wsse:Reference URI="#ABCXYZ-9F0F7E15A59816E680B4735080A789DC1EED6C9C" ValueType="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-x509-token-profile-1.0#X509v3"/>
// </wsse:SecurityTokenReference>
// </ds:KeyInfo>
// </ds:Signature>
// </wsse:Security>
// <wsa:Action>http://wcf.dian.colombia/IWcfDianCustomerServices/GetStatus</wsa:Action>
// <wsa:To wsu:Id="ID-F25839120CBA3ECDAD68754D0443A667636FDA68" xmlns:wsu="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-wssecurity-utility-1.0.xsd">https://vpfe-hab.dian.gov.co/WcfDianCustomerServices.svc</wsa:To>
// </soap:Header>
// <soap:Body>
// <wcf:GetStatus>
// <wcf:trackId>123456666</wcf:trackId>
// </wcf:GetStatus>
// </soap:Body>
// </soap:Envelope>
// Use this online tool to generate code from sample Signed XML:
// Generate Code to Create Signed XML
success := 1;
// Create the XML to be signed...
xmlToSign := TChilkatXml.Create(Self);
xmlToSign.Tag := 'soap:Envelope';
xmlToSign.AddAttribute('xmlns:soap','http://www.w3.org/2003/05/soap-envelope');
xmlToSign.AddAttribute('xmlns:wcf','http://wcf.dian.colombia');
xmlToSign.UpdateAttrAt('soap:Header',1,'xmlns:wsa','http://www.w3.org/2005/08/addressing');
xmlToSign.UpdateAttrAt('soap:Header|wsse:Security',1,'xmlns:wsse','http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-wssecurity-secext-1.0.xsd');
xmlToSign.UpdateAttrAt('soap:Header|wsse:Security',1,'xmlns:wsu','http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-wssecurity-utility-1.0.xsd');
xmlToSign.UpdateAttrAt('soap:Header|wsse:Security|wsu:Timestamp',1,'wsu:Id','TS-F25839120CBA3ECDAD68754D0443A667636FDA68');
xmlToSign.UpdateChildContent('soap:Header|wsse:Security|wsu:Timestamp|wsu:Created','2019-08-23T23:03:01Z');
xmlToSign.UpdateChildContent('soap:Header|wsse:Security|wsu:Timestamp|wsu:Expires','2019-08-24T15:43:01Z');
xmlToSign.UpdateAttrAt('soap:Header|wsse:Security|wsse:BinarySecurityToken',1,'EncodingType','http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-soap-message-security-1.0#Base64Binary');
xmlToSign.UpdateAttrAt('soap:Header|wsse:Security|wsse:BinarySecurityToken',1,'ValueType','http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-x509-token-profile-1.0#X509v3');
xmlToSign.UpdateAttrAt('soap:Header|wsse:Security|wsse:BinarySecurityToken',1,'wsu:Id','ABCXYZ-9F0F7E15A59816E680B4735080A789DC1EED6C9C');
xmlToSign.UpdateChildContent('soap:Header|wsse:Security|wsse:BinarySecurityToken','BinarySecurityToken_Base64Binary_Content');
xmlToSign.UpdateChildContent('soap:Header|wsa:Action','http://wcf.dian.colombia/IWcfDianCustomerServices/GetStatus');
xmlToSign.UpdateAttrAt('soap:Header|wsa:To',1,'wsu:Id','ID-F25839120CBA3ECDAD68754D0443A667636FDA68');
xmlToSign.UpdateAttrAt('soap:Header|wsa:To',1,'xmlns:wsu','http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-wssecurity-utility-1.0.xsd');
xmlToSign.UpdateChildContent('soap:Header|wsa:To','https://vpfe-hab.dian.gov.co/WcfDianCustomerServices.svc');
xmlToSign.UpdateChildContent('soap:Body|wcf:GetStatus|wcf:trackId','123456666');
gen := TChilkatXmlDSigGen.Create(Self);
gen.SigLocation := 'soap:Envelope|soap:Header|wsse:Security';
gen.SigLocationMod := 0;
gen.SigId := 'SIG-F25839120CBA3ECDAD68754D0443A667636FDA68';
gen.SigNamespacePrefix := 'ds';
gen.SigNamespaceUri := 'http://www.w3.org/2000/09/xmldsig#';
gen.SignedInfoCanonAlg := 'EXCL_C14N';
gen.SignedInfoDigestMethod := 'sha256';
// Set the KeyInfoId before adding references..
gen.KeyInfoId := 'KI-F25839120CBA3ECDAD68754D0443A667636FDA68';
// -------- Reference 1 --------
gen.AddSameDocRef('ID-F25839120CBA3ECDAD68754D0443A667636FDA68','sha256','EXCL_C14N','soap wcf','');
// Provide a certificate + private key. (PFX password is test123)
cert := TChilkatCert.Create(Self);
success := cert.LoadPfxFile('qa_data/pfx/cert_test123.pfx','test123');
if (success <> 1) then
begin
Memo1.Lines.Add(cert.LastErrorText);
Exit;
end;
gen.SetX509Cert(cert.ControlInterface,1);
gen.KeyInfoType := 'Custom';
// Create the custom KeyInfo XML..
xmlCustomKeyInfo := TChilkatXml.Create(Self);
xmlCustomKeyInfo.Tag := 'wsse:SecurityTokenReference';
xmlCustomKeyInfo.AddAttribute('wsu:Id','STR-F25839120CBA3ECDAD68754D0443A667636FDA68');
xmlCustomKeyInfo.UpdateAttrAt('wsse:Reference',1,'URI','#ABCXYZ-9F0F7E15A59816E680B4735080A789DC1EED6C9C');
xmlCustomKeyInfo.UpdateAttrAt('wsse:Reference',1,'ValueType','http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-x509-token-profile-1.0#X509v3');
xmlCustomKeyInfo.EmitXmlDecl := 0;
gen.CustomKeyInfoXml := xmlCustomKeyInfo.GetXml();
// Load XML to be signed...
sbXml := TChilkatStringBuilder.Create(Self);
xmlToSign.GetXmlSb(sbXml.ControlInterface);
// Update BinarySecurityToken_Base64Binary_Content with the actual X509 of the signing cert.
bdCert := TChilkatBinData.Create(Self);
cert.ExportCertDerBd(bdCert.ControlInterface);
nReplaced := sbXml.Replace('BinarySecurityToken_Base64Binary_Content',bdCert.GetEncoded('base64'));
gen.Behaviors := 'IndentedSignature';
// Sign the XML...
success := gen.CreateXmlDSigSb(sbXml.ControlInterface);
if (success <> 1) then
begin
Memo1.Lines.Add(gen.LastErrorText);
Exit;
end;
// -----------------------------------------------
// Save the signed XML to a file.
success := sbXml.WriteFile('qa_output/signedXml.xml','utf-8',0);
Memo1.Lines.Add(sbXml.GetAsString());
// ----------------------------------------
// Verify the signatures we just produced...
verifier := TChilkatXmlDSig.Create(Self);
success := verifier.LoadSignatureSb(sbXml.ControlInterface);
if (success <> 1) then
begin
Memo1.Lines.Add(verifier.LastErrorText);
Exit;
end;
numSigs := verifier.NumSignatures;
verifyIdx := 0;
while verifyIdx < numSigs do
begin
verifier.Selector := verifyIdx;
verified := verifier.VerifySignature(1);
if (verified <> 1) then
begin
Memo1.Lines.Add(verifier.LastErrorText);
Exit;
end;
verifyIdx := verifyIdx + 1;
end;
Memo1.Lines.Add('All signatures were successfully verified.');
